Tama Table Lamp
Isao Hosoe / Valenti Luce - 1975
Table or suspension lamp designed by the prolific Japanese industrial designer Isao Hosoe in 1975 and produced by the Italian firm Valenti Luce.
Simple design based on a tinted, low-pressure polyethylene balloon to which a red injected plastic support is screwed that includes the lamp holder and functions as a handle.
It can be used both indoors and outdoors, thanks to the use of simple materials and minimal construction details. It provides a warm and soft light.
